When received my first bill I was surprised to see it was £11.30 because I had been charged for weekend calls.
When I called the helpline they told me I couldn't have the free weekend calls because I had paid my line rental upfront and free weekend calls weren't included when I had the upfront line rental saving. This didn't make much sense to me as I don't see how the two are related. I was told I would have to pay an extra £1.50 a month to have weekend calls, I wasn't happy but reluctantly agreed and was then told my monthly charges would be £11.49 a month. This came as a shock as £2.75 plus £ 1.50 is £4.25 where does £11.49 come from. The call centre technician agreed I was correct and quickly ended the call.
The call centre technician didnt inspire me with much confidence so I decided to call again just to confirm what my monthly charges would be. This time a different technician explained that I could have weekend calls included with my line rental saver but that it had been set up as line only and that it now was impossible to change. Seems like a very poor show by plusnet that they are unable to correct customers accounts and the first technician was clearly talking rubbish.
I asked the technician if he would email me details of what my monthly standard charges would now be to save any further confusion. He said he would, I asked him to email me while I was on the phone so I could confirm I'd recieved it but he point blank refused to do this giving no logical reason. He said he would email me as soon as I got off the phone.
Needless to say I am still waiting for his email, he told me his name was [mremoved] but given the level of lies from plusnet so far I doubt that it is.
My next months bill should be £4.25 but I'm guessing plusnet will have some other small print or excuse where they will be able to get away with charging me more.
I only moved from BT to plusnet to get away from this [Censored] but so far it's looking worse. Come back BT all is forgiven.

When you take the Line Rental Saver you lose the weekend calls and you can't get them back.
However you can add Evenings and Weekends for a charge of £1.50 per month http://www.plus.net/support/phone/home-phone-faq.shtml#callPlans as already stated but not weekends only
